Sourcing guidance for Laboratory Equipment
How to evaluate the technical specifications and precision of laboratory equipment?
When sourcing laboratory equipment, precision and repeatability are paramount. You must verify the Accuracy Class and Resolution of the instruments. For analytical balances, ensure they meet OIML R76 standards; for thermal equipment like incubators, check for Temperature Uniformity within ±0.5°C. Always request Calibration Certificates (CNAS or NIST traceable) to ensure the equipment performs within specified tolerances.
What are the essential compliance and safety standards for international procurement?
Laboratory equipment must adhere to strict safety protocols. Ensure the supplier provides CE Marking for the European market or UL/ETL Certification for North America. For medical-related lab gear, ISO 13485 and FDA Registration are mandatory. Additionally, verify compliance with IEC 61010-1, which is the specific safety requirement for electrical equipment for measurement, control, and laboratory use.
How to ensure the chemical and biological compatibility of the materials used?
The durability of lab equipment depends on material science. Ensure that surfaces are made of AISI 316L Stainless Steel or High-Density Polyethylene (HDPE) for corrosion resistance. For glassware, Borosilicate 3.3 glass is the industry standard due to its thermal shock resistance. If the equipment is used in sterile environments, confirm that the materials can withstand Autoclaving (121°C at 15 psi) without degradation.
What should be considered regarding software integration and data integrity?
Modern laboratories require digital connectivity. Ensure the equipment supports RS232, USB, or Ethernet interfaces for data export. For pharmaceutical applications, the software must be compliant with 21 CFR Part 11, ensuring Audit Trails, electronic signatures, and data security. Confirm if the supplier provides SDKs or API documentation for integration into your existing LIMS (Laboratory Information Management System).
Cross-Border Procurement Risks and Strategic Advice
How to mitigate the risk of damage during international transit?
Laboratory equipment is often fragile and sensitive to vibration. You must mandate Vacuum Packaging and Wooden Crate Fumigation (ISPM 15). Require the use of ShockWatch and TiltWatch indicators on the exterior packaging to monitor handling. For high-precision optics or lasers, specify Air Freight over sea freight to minimize prolonged exposure to humidity and mechanical stress.
What are the best practices for negotiating with Chinese laboratory equipment manufacturers?
Focus on the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for a 2-year extended warranty and the inclusion of Critical Spare Parts Kits (e.g., gaskets, fuses, sensors) in the initial order. How to handle after-sales technical support and installation across borders?
Technical complexity requires robust support. Negotiate for Remote Installation Guidance via video conferencing and ensure the supplier provides Operation & Maintenance (O&M) Manuals in English. For complex systems like HPLC or NMR, confirm if the supplier has Local Service Partners or if they can provide Virtual Reality (VR) training modules for your technicians.
